Listed on three major stock markets: Nasdaq (US), Euronext Amsterdam (Netherlands) and IBEX 35 (Spain), we are also member of the Dow Jones Sustainability Index and FTSE4Good. We operate in more than 15 countries and have a workforce of over 24,000 professionals worldwide. Ferrovial’s activity is carried out through our business units, including Highways, Airports, Construction, and Energy.
The Airport business unit has over 25 years of experience investing in and managing some of the world's most complex airports, including London Heathrow Airport. Today, our diverse portfolio includes Dalaman International Airport in Türkiye, and the lead investor and industrial partner in the consortium appointed to design, construct, and operate the New Terminal One at New York’s John F. Kennedy International Airport in the United States. We also participate in FMM, providing facility management services, notably under a main contract with Hamad International Airport in Doha, Qatar. We are currently in the process is expanding the global airport investment portfolio and anticipate new additions to come soon.

Job Description:
About The Role:
The Graduate, within the Asset Management department, will collaborate in the analysis and reporting of the Assets under Ferrovial Airports division.
Key Responsabilities:
- Support in the development of bottom-up forecast for estimating the airport’s future performance related to traffic, aero income, non-aero income, and opex.
- Collaborate on the analysis of specific projects where a technical overview of the shareholders is needed.
- Support on the preparation of commercial proposals for airlines, retail and F&B operators, in coordination with the assets.
- Provide reports on traffic, income and opex of the assets.
- Research and communicate market intelligence relevant to the assets.
- Collaborate with the M&A department on the technical analysis of potential bids by the company.
- Contribute to the review of the tasks carried out or outsourced to external partners to develop estimates of demand, revenue, costs and infrastructure investments of the bids that the division submits.
- Support in the development and review of the operational models for bidding processes and asset management.
- Prepare and update the financial and operational reports and models used in Ferrovial Airports, including SOX compliant reports.
- Support in any ad-hoc request (documentation/presentations/analysis) required by the team.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or´s degree in Engineering or Finance.
- Master´s degree will be highly valued.
- Relevant academic record in the aviation industry.
- Previous experience in the transportation and aviation consulting industry will be valued.
- High level of English is essential.
- Advanced Excel usage is mandatory.
